Tuesday, July 04, 2006

We have Liftoff... Independence day 2006

Mission STS-121 is launched on Independence Day... the best fireworks ever for NASA... It may be 3 days later than scheduled but I think one should never overlook coincidences.
We wish the crew Bon Voyage and a safe return, may this be a sign of more success in the future for NASA and all the people that strive to further the exploration of our Universe.

No comments: